Martin Short Spotted with J.J. Abrams After Daughter's Death

About this episode

Martin Short, following his daughter Katherines tragic suicide, makes a public appearance in Los Angeles, dining with J.J. Abrams. Katherine, a licensed clinical social worker, was one of three children Martin adopted with his late wife. The family, including Martins friends like Selena Gomez, seeks privacy as they grieve, while Martin and Steve Martin resume their comedy tour on April 11th.

Martin Short made his first public appearance in Los Angeles since losing his daughter Catherine back in February. The 76-year-old comedian was spotted grabbing dinner in Santa Monica with his buddy, director J.J. Abrams on March 27. He slipped into Abrams' car without chatting to the photographers hanging around. Martin was 42 when she passed, and investigators ruled it a suicide after LAPD responded to a call in the Hollywood Hills on February 23. She was one of three kids, Martin adopted with his late wife, Nancy Dolman, who died from ovarian cancer in 2010. Cavern worked as a licensed clinical social worker in L.A. for over a decade. Neighbors called her death incredibly sad, and folks close to the family shared how she lit up rooms with her energy. Martin's pals, like Selena Gomez from their only murder show, rallied around him, and even Conan O'Brien gave a quiet nod during the Oscars on March 15.

Right after the loss, Martin and Steve Martin pushed back their comedy tour dates, but they're gearing up to hit the stage again on April 11, in Savannah, Georgia, with the full band. The family still craves privacy as they grieve, reminding us all that support lines like 98 are there, if anyone's struggling.
